Lucas Heitz was nominated for Football Player of the Game at Bondurant on August 24. He is the son of Eric and Ann Heitz and is a senior this year.
Heitz has been playing football since he was in fourth grade. He loves the football team because he thinks it’s fun to be a part of a team because football requires a lot of teamwork.
To Heitz, being Player of the Game makes him feel good about how he played.
Heitz thinks he was honored as Player of the Game because he did a good job and was a good teammate to his team and works hard at practice.
In recognition of Heitz’s achievements, Fuller Standard Service, Inc. has donated $50 to the ADM Scholarship Foundation.
